Darma is located in the Kumaon region of Uttarakhand, India. It’s close to the India-Tibet border and offers breathtaking views of the snow-capped peaks of the Himalayas. Darma Valley is one of the most beautiful valleys in the Himalayas, situated at the base of the Panchachuli peaks. It's similar to Ladakh and Spiti, yet still an offbeat and splendid destination.

Sketch Itinerary
Day 1 - Dharchula to Darma Valley
Approx 5hrs drive. Check in to the homestay for overnight stay at Darma Valley.
Day 2 - Panchachuli Base Camp Trek
Total 7km trek. Return to homestay for overnight stay at Darma Valley.
Day 3 - Village Walk
Explore Film, Daatu, and Dugtu villages (approx 6-7kms walk). Enjoy panoramic views of the Panchachuli peaks and misty mountains. Connect with the local culture and enjoy homemade local cuisine. Overnight stay at Darma Valley.
Day 4 - Departure to Dharchula
Drive back. Trip ends here.

What is the best time for the Darma Valley trek?
The best time to embark on the Darma Valley trek is during the post-monsoon season, from September to November.
